INSIGHT PHYSICIANS CARE LLC
Family Medicine
INSIGHT PHYSICIANS CARE LLC is a Family Medicine in BLOOMINGDALE, IL, US.
1 TIFFANY PT STE 106,
BLOOMINGDALE, IL, US
2246539507